Over a quarter of the people in Ceduna identify as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ander, which is far above the national figure. The area is home to 1,955 people and has a noticeably younger feel than most similar places. This is reflected in the high number of children and a typical age of just 37.

How the population splits across age groups.
Children under 15 make up 21.6% of the population, a figure well above the national average. This helps explain why the area is younger than most others, while seniors aged 65 and over sit at 18.1%.

First Nations identity and marital status.
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ander identity is very common here at 26.4%, which is far above the state and national figures. De facto relationships are also much more common than usual, accounting for 19.2% of residents.
